Bettor:


bettor is an excellent device for settling plumbing issues. It is made use of to clear obstructions in bathrooms, kitchen area sinks, and various other drains pipes in your home. There are various kinds of plungers for managing various types of drain clogs so you need to have different types as well as sizes of bettor depending on the one that fits your drains. There are 2 major types of bettor: the flange and the cup. Each of these has its specific applications for cleaning up drain blockages.
A container wrench: this is an additional tool that needs to remain in every residence. When doing plumbing repairs, it may be necessary to loosen up bolts and also sink plumbing components. The basin wrench makes this possible as well as is likewise utilized to tighten nuts as well. This wrench has a head that pivots at the back and front. This assists to reach smaller nuts or hold the faucet handles and also pipelines.

Pliers:


The kind of pliers recommended for plumbing is the tongue-and-groove pliers. They are made use of to tighten up as well as loosen nuts and screws. They can likewise be controlled to hold nuts and screws in position and use to hold and pick items. Pliers are really beneficial devices for DIY plumbing technicians.

Auger:


This is likewise referred to as a drain snake and is made use of for getting rid of drainpipe clogs. This tool is put right into blocked drains to take out blockages and gunk from the drainpipe. You put it in the drain and also spin it to break clogs right into tinier little bits for easy cleansing.

Teflon tape:


This is likewise typically called plumber's tape. It is used to snugly secure heap joints as well as fitting. The tapes are in rolls reduced to certain sizes and also sizes. It is a bulletproof seal and as a result of this, it can be utilized to hold off leakages till professional help arrives.

Signs You Need to Call an Emergency Plumber


Most people don’t anticipate having a plumbing problem. After all, your home’s piping is probably the last thing on your mind, even as you wash your hands, flush the toilet, and take a shower. If you think you’re having an emergency, call a plumber as soon as possible.


TOP 10 REASONS TO CALL AN EMERGENCY PLUMBER


  • Gurgling sounds: Something could be blocking your sewer line if the toilet gurgles when you drain the bathtub, or if you hear gurgling from the sink while the washing machine runs. Call an emergency plumber before the problem develops into a backed-up sewer!


  • Stubborn toilet clog: If a foreign object has lodged itself in the drainpipe, a plunger will only get you so far. An emergency plumber has more advanced tools and techniques to clear stubborn toilet clogs.


  • Shower or sink won’t drain: You may find that you can’t clear a stopped-up sink or shower drain with the tools available to you. To get things flowing again, call a plumber for drain cleaning services.


  • Sounds of water running: If you hear water running through the pipes while no one is using the plumbing, there could be a leak somewhere. You need expert leak detection to locate and fix the source of the problem before it causes any more harm.


  • Sewage odor: Be wary of bad smells with no apparent source. A broken sewer vent or pipe could be to blame, which is not only unpleasant but could also cause environmental and health issues. Professional sewer repair should set things right again.


  • Low water pressure: Sometimes, you can blame a lack of water flow on a clogged aerator. Unscrew this from the faucet and soak it in vinegar to remove mineral deposits. If the problem persists, call a professional for help.


  • Frozen pipes: Low water pressure in the winter could be caused by a frozen pipe. You must act fast to prevent the pipe from bursting and potentially causing significant water damage.


  • Burst or dripping pipes: If you’re too late, and a frozen pipe has burst, don’t panic—turn the main water shut-off valve to stop the flow of water and prevent property damage until an emergency plumber arrives.


  • No hot water: A problem with your water heater can make a hot shower suddenly turn ice-cold. Fortunately, an emergency plumber can perform the repair you need to restore your supply of hot water.


  • Leaking fixture or hose: If you see water flowing out from under the dishwasher, washing machine, or ice maker, the hose behind the appliance may have sprung a leak. See if you can tighten the connection to stop the dripping. Otherwise, turn off the water and call an emergency plumber.
